How to Choose the Right ECG Lead Wire Supplier: 4 Essential Dimensions & Red Flags
In cardiac monitoring and electrocardiogram (ECG) diagnostics, the ECG lead wire assembly serves as the vital signal link between the patient and the medical device. Signal integrity, biocompatibility, and flex life directly determine ECG trace clarity and patient safety.
For medical device manufacturers (OEM/ODM) and hospital procurement teams, selecting a reliable ECG cable and lead wire supplier is a critical decision. Here is a comprehensive guide detailing the four core evaluation criteria and a quick supplier checklist.
Dimension 1: Regulatory Compliance & Certifications (The Non-Negotiables)
Medical cables and lead wires fall under medical device accessories/components. Compliance is the mandatory entry barrier:
Quality Management System: Does the manufacturer hold ISO 13485 certification? This guarantees full product traceability and batch consistency.
Global Market Access: Do products meet target market regulations, such as CE MDR (Europe), FDA 510(k) (USA), and NMPA (China) registration requirements?
Biocompatibility Standards: Has the outer jacket material passed ISO 10993 testing (cytotoxicity, skin irritation, and sensitization) to ensure safe, long-term patient skin contact?
Dimension 2: Product Performance & Cable Engineering
A high-performance ECG lead wire must deliver clean signal transmission and withstand demanding clinical environments:

Durability & Mechanical Strength
Jacket Material: Medical-grade TPU/TPE is strongly preferred over low-end PVC. TPU/TPE offers superior wear resistance, skin-friendly feel, and high resistance to medical disinfectants (alcohol, iodine, etc.).

Dimension 3: Customization (OEM/ODM) & Engineering Agility
Medical equipment designs vary across patient monitors, holter monitors, and EKG machines:
Tailored Specifications: Ability to customize cable lengths, color coding (AHA vs. IEC standards), lead configurations (3-lead, 5-lead, 10-lead), and anti-entanglement yoke splitters.
Rapid Prototyping: Fast turnaround for technical drawings, tooling, and NPI (New Product Introduction) sample delivery within 1 to 2 weeks.
Dimension 4: Cleanroom Manufacturing & 100% Quality Assurance
Controlled Environment: Stripping, soldering, and overmolding executed in Class 100,000 (ISO Class 8) cleanrooms to eliminate dust contamination and preserve electrical insulation.
100% Factory Inspection: Every single assembly must undergo automated testing for continuity, short circuits, high-voltage insulation, and signal attenuation prior to shipment.
